Nerd HQ 2011 took place at a bar/cafe in the Gaslamp District, less then 5 minute walk from SDCC. It was equipped with Xbox 360 consoles (20+) and games that had not yet publicly released; Gunslinger, SpiderMan: Edge of Time, StarWars (Kinect), Gears of War 3, Rayman, Dance Central, and a few others. It was free to visit the NERD HQ venue and play these games.
During the 4 day event there were charity discussion panels, where celebs sat in a room of about 150 fans spoke for about 30 mins (aprx) answering questions for the other 30 mins (aprx)- a signing session usually followed. Discussion celebs from 2011 INCLUDED- Jared Padalecki (Supernatural), Seth Green (Robot Chicken and a bunch of moovies), Kevin Smith & Jason Mewes (Jay and Silent Bob), Psych panel with James Roday and Dulé Hill, A firefly cast panel with Alan Tudyk, Adam Baldwin and Jewel Staite, Nathan Fillion (Castle, Firefly), Zachary Levi introduced most of the panels and was on about 4 or 5 of them.
The Charity Discussion Panels of 2011 only cost you a $20 donation to Operation Smile. In addition to attending the panel the charitable panel attendees received a Nerd HQ lanyard, Nerd HQ Bracelet, assigned seating (so one less line to sit in for hours hoping for a good seat), and -in most cases- autographs from the panel celeb.
Nerd HQ also hosted a scavenger hunt and a Gears of War 3 play off with Zachary Levi (<--it was a surprise and not on a public schedule). The NERD party was on Friday night- this is not a 'hang out with celebs' event, they had their own VIP party going on upstairs.
Throughout the 4 days celebs would randomly roam the public (non VIP) areas such as Zachary Levi (although after about 5 minutes he'd get mobbed and have to leave but he did come around a coupe times a day), Adam Baldwin sat at the bar with his wife and chatted with Firefly/Chuck fans for quite awhile, Mark Christopher Lawrence (aka Big Mike of Chuck) was spotted on the main floor quite a few times and was never too busy to chat with you or take a photo. James Roday and Dulé Hill were both hanging out at the venue days before their panel. *these were just SOME of the instances I witnessed, I have been privy to hear second hand stories of celeb sighting at the venue like Chevy Chase, Alexander Skarsgård (True Blood), Elijah Wood (Lord of the Rings), and more.

Dates: July 12-15. based off last year. it ran concurrent with SDCC.
Location: Culy Warehouse, 335 Sixth Street, San Diego (2-3 blocks from SDCC.
It's going bigger in 2012. Culy Warehouse is huge and 3 levels. I always rave on how epic 2011 was, but now 2012 looks to top it.
